What is a Second Router?
Adding a second router to your existing network involves connecting another router to your primary one, typically with an Ethernet cable. This setup doesn't just extend your Wi-Fi signal; it creates an entirely new, independent network alongside your original one.
- Creates a New Network: A second router establishes its own distinct Wi-Fi network, complete with a separate name (SSID) and password. It operates independently from the primary router's network.
- Requires a Wired Connection: For this configuration to work, the second router must be physically connected to the main router using an Ethernet cable. This hardwired link is essential for its operation.
- Manages Its Own Traffic: It handles its own data traffic and device connections, which can help distribute the network load and prevent congestion on the primary network.
- Offers Advanced Configuration: A second router can be configured to create a subnet. This is useful for isolating guest traffic or specific departments for enhanced security and traffic management.
What is an Extender?
A Wi-Fi extender, also known as a repeater, is a device designed to boost and rebroadcast your existing Wi-Fi signal. It captures the wireless signal from your primary router and extends its coverage to areas where the signal is weak or non-existent, such as distant offices or floors.
- Extends the Existing Network: An extender rebroadcasts your current Wi-Fi signal, typically under the same network name (SSID). Devices can switch between the router and the extender as you move around.
- Connects Wirelessly: It connects to your primary router wirelessly, offering flexibility in placement. All it needs is a power outlet within the range of the main router's signal.
- Shares Bandwidth: The extender shares bandwidth from the primary router. This means that while coverage is expanded, the connection speeds for devices on the extender may be lower than on the main network.
- Simple Installation: Extenders are generally designed for a straightforward, plug-and-play setup, requiring minimal technical configuration to get running.
Second Router vs Extender: Key Differences
While both solutions expand your Wi-Fi coverage, they do so with significant trade-offs in performance, management, and setup. Here’s a closer look at the main distinctions.
1. Performance and Speed
A second router connects via an Ethernet cable, giving it a direct, stable link to your primary network. This means it can deliver speeds nearly identical to your main router without degrading overall network performance.
An extender, however, connects wirelessly and must split its bandwidth between receiving the signal from the router and rebroadcasting it to your devices. This process effectively cuts the available speed in half for any devices connected to it.
2. Network Management and Security
Because a second router creates an entirely separate network, it offers greater control. You can configure it as a subnet to isolate traffic for security, such as creating a dedicated guest network or segmenting departmental access.
An extender simply mirrors the settings of your primary router. It offers no independent management features and operates as a single, unified network, meaning there is no way to isolate traffic between the extender and the main router.
3. Installation and Physical Setup
Extenders are designed for simplicity and can be placed anywhere with a power outlet that is within range of the main router’s signal. The setup is typically a quick, plug-and-play process.
A second router requires a physical Ethernet cable run from the primary router to its location. This can be a more complex and costly installation, especially in larger buildings or across different floors.
Benefits of Using a Second Router
Opting for a second router brings several key advantages, especially in a business environment where performance and security are paramount.
- Greater Network Stability: The required Ethernet connection provides a reliable, high-speed link that isn't susceptible to the wireless interference that can disrupt extenders. This ensures consistent performance for critical operations.
- Advanced Security Segmentation: You can create a completely separate network for specific uses, like guest access or handling sensitive departmental data. This isolation is a powerful tool for protecting your core network infrastructure.
- Effective Load Balancing: By dividing devices between two routers, you prevent network congestion. This is particularly useful in device-heavy areas, ensuring that performance doesn't degrade for users on the primary network.
- Dedicated Network Functions: A second router can be configured for specialized tasks, such as creating a VPN gateway for secure remote work or prioritizing voice traffic to maintain clear communication.
Advantages of Using an Extender
Despite their limitations, extenders offer practical benefits in certain situations, particularly when simplicity and cost are the main drivers.
- Cost-Effective Solution: Extenders are significantly less expensive than purchasing a second router, making them an ideal choice for addressing coverage gaps on a tight budget.
- Rapid Deployment: Their plug-and-play nature means they can be set up in minutes without technical expertise or the disruption of running new cables through the office.
- Flexible Placement: Because they don't need a wired connection back to the main router, you can easily test different locations to find the optimal spot for eliminating a dead zone.
- Maintains a Single Network: An extender keeps your existing network name and password, providing a more straightforward user experience for employees who don't have to switch between different networks as they move through the workspace.
Choosing the Right Solution for Your Network Needs
Making the right choice comes down to a clear-eyed evaluation of your business requirements for performance, security, and scale. Your decision should be guided by the primary problem you are trying to solve, not just the desire for more coverage.
- Opt for a second router if: Your main priority is maintaining high performance for demanding applications like VoIP, video conferencing, or large data transfers. It is the correct choice when you need to create a separate, secure network for guests or specific departments to isolate traffic. A second router is also ideal for offloading a significant number of devices from a congested primary network, ensuring stability for everyone. This is the path for when performance and security are non-negotiable.
- Go with a Wi-Fi extender if: You simply need to eliminate a small Wi-Fi dead zone with minimal fuss and on a tight budget. An extender is perfectly suitable for areas where network usage is light—think basic email, web browsing, or connecting a few IoT devices. It's the most practical pick when running an Ethernet cable is not feasible or cost-effective, and you need a quick fix for a coverage gap without any complex configuration.

Frequently Asked Questions about Second Router vs Extender
Can I use any router as a second router?
Yes, most modern routers can be configured to function as a second router in "access point mode." You will need to disable its DHCP feature to prevent conflicts with your primary router and connect it via an Ethernet cable for it to work correctly.
How do mesh networks compare to these two options?
Mesh systems are a more advanced solution. They use multiple nodes that communicate with each other to form a single, unified network. They provide better performance than extenders and are simpler to manage than a second router, though they often have a higher price point.
Will an extender slow down my entire network?
An extender will not slow down devices connected directly to your main router. However, because it uses bandwidth to function, heavy traffic on the extended part of the network can affect overall performance. Devices connected to the extender will always experience slower speeds.
